Planning a bathroom remodel can be exciting, but there are lots of details to consider. One important question is: does your chosen bathroom fitter include removing old fixtures in their services? Some fitters may only focus on installing the new pieces, leaving you to deal with getting rid of the outdated sinks, toilets, and faucets yourself. Others offer a more comprehensive service that encompasses both installation and removal. It's essential to confirm this upfront to avoid any surprises. Ask your potential fitters directly about their procedures regarding old fixture removal and get it in writing before signing any contracts.
Shower Room vs Open Shower: What's Right for You?
When it comes to creating a luxurious bathing space, the choice between a traditional shower room and a open concept shower can be tough. Both choices offer unique pros and drawbacks, so it's essential to carefully weigh your needs before making a choice.
- Traditional showers typically includes a enclosed shower space and a individual section for other toiletries, like a vanity. This setup offers discrete spaces between wet and dry areas, making it a practical option for limited space.
- Open shower designs, on the other hand, abolish the fixed shower enclosure, creating a unified design. The entire wet zone is graded to drain effectively, allowing for a liberating bathing experience. This option is particularly ideal for larger spaces where maximum space utilization is a priority.
In conclusion, the best choice between a ensuite and a wet room relies on your individual needs. Consider factors like bathroom size, budget, daily routines, and aesthetic preferences to select the alternative that best suits your needs.
Leading Garage Conversions in Manchester
Looking to boost your living space? A garage conversion can be the perfect solution! Manchester is thriving with talented contractors who can transform your old garage into a functional new room. Whether you're after an extra bathroom, a play room, or even a guest suite, there are endless possibilities!
Manchester is known for its vibrant architectural styles, so you can easily find a conversion that complements your home's existing charm. From classic designs to green solutions, the options are truly abundant.
To begin your garage conversion journey in Manchester, here are a few things to consider:
* **Your budget:** Garage conversions can range in cost depending on the size and scope of the project. It's important to have a clear idea of how much you're willing to spend before you begin.
* **Planning permission:** You may need planning permission from your local council before you can start work on your garage conversion.
* **Choosing the right contractor:** Finding a reputable and experienced contractor is essential for a successful project. Make sure to get several quotes and check references before making your decision.
With careful planning and the right team, your garage conversion can be a rewarding investment that advances your home's value and living space.

Bathroom Fitting: Who Takes Care of the Old Fittings?
So you've decided to renovate your bathroom! Exciting times. But before you start imagining that sleek new shower or luxurious bathtub, there's a crucial question to address: who handles those old fittings? Generally, the onus falls on the contractor responsible for your bathroom makeover. They'll remove everything from your outdated sink and toilet to that worn-out bathtub.
Of course, it's always a good idea to discuss this detail upfront when agreeing your contract. This way, you avoid any unpleasant situations down the line. After all, a smooth and hassle-free bathroom fitting experience is what we all strive for.
